About this home

The listing, in the seller's words

Lovely and beautifully remodeled rancher located on quiet cul de sac in heart of Fox Hill. 3 bedrooms, 1.5 baths, open air living room and step down family room. New kitchen cabinets and counters. New light fixtures and more.

Flood & environment

FEMA flood zone AE · base flood elevation 8 ft · Special Flood Hazard Area (flood insurance typically required) · FIRM 515527

Flood Risk

Looking up FEMA flood zone…

Zone AE typically means lenders require flood insurance — factor it into the monthly numbers below.

Hurricane Evacuation Zone

Evacuation Zone A

Source: Virginia Dept. of Emergency Management — Know Your Zone

Questions buyers ask

Real questions, answered from the record

Is 121 Duval Ct in a good school zone?+
The assigned zones on the listing record are Phillips Elementary (GreatSchools 7/10), Benjamin Syms Middle (GreatSchools 4/10), Kecoughtan (GreatSchools 6/10). School attendance zones can change — always confirm enrollment with the local school division.
Is 121 Duval Ct in a flood zone?+
FEMA maps this parcel in Zone AE with a base flood elevation of 8 ft — a high-risk flood band where lenders typically require flood insurance. See the flood section on this page for the full details and sources, and verify with an elevation certificate.
Does 121 Duval Ct have an HOA?+
No — there are no HOA, condo, or association dues on the listing record for this property.
When was 121 Duval Ct built?+
It was built in 1964, per the listing record.
